Chemotherapy for <a href="https://acibademinternational.com/diseases/acute-myeloid-leukemia/”>acute myeloid leukemia (AML) is a core treatment that uses anti-cancer medicines to destroy leukemia cells in the blood and bone marrow. Treatment is individualized according to the person’s age, overall health, AML subtype, genetic findings and response to initial therapy.

Overview: how chemotherapy for acute myeloid leukemia works

Chemotherapy for acute myeloid leukemia uses medicines that damage or stop the growth of rapidly dividing leukemia cells. AML begins in the bone marrow, where abnormal immature white blood cells multiply and interfere with normal production of red blood cells, platelets and healthy infection-fighting cells. Chemotherapy aims to clear these abnormal cells from the blood and bone marrow so normal blood formation can recover.

For many adults who are fit enough for intensive treatment, chemotherapy is delivered in two broad phases: induction and consolidation. Induction is intended to achieve complete remission, meaning no leukemia is visible using standard tests and blood counts recover. Consolidation follows remission and treats small amounts of leukemia that may remain below the level of routine detection.

Some people are offered lower-intensity chemotherapy or medicines that target specific leukemia-related genetic changes instead. The treatment plan may also include bone marrow transplantation when the expected risk of AML returning is high or when AML does not respond adequately to initial treatment. A specialist hematology-oncology team reviews the options with the person and their family.

Who may be a candidate for AML chemotherapy?

Most people diagnosed with AML are assessed for chemotherapy promptly because the disease can progress quickly. However, the best approach is not identical for everyone. Before treatment starts, the team considers physical fitness, age, other medical conditions, kidney and liver function, current infections, previous cancer treatment and the person’s goals and preferences.

Testing the leukemia cells is especially important. Bone marrow samples are examined under a microscope and tested for chromosome changes and gene mutations. These findings help classify AML, estimate the likelihood of response or relapse, and identify whether a targeted medicine may be appropriate alongside or instead of standard chemotherapy.

Intensive chemotherapy is often considered for people who can tolerate its short-term effects. For people who are older, frail or living with significant medical conditions, lower-intensity regimens may offer a safer balance of benefit and risk. Supportive care is important at every stage, including transfusions, infection prevention, nutrition support and symptom management.

What happens during AML chemotherapy?

Before treatment, the care team performs blood tests, bone marrow testing and assessments of heart, kidney and liver function. A central venous catheter may be placed to make intravenous treatment, blood sampling and transfusions more manageable. The team also discusses fertility preservation where appropriate, as some treatments can affect future fertility.

Induction chemotherapy is commonly given in hospital because it can lower blood counts profoundly and requires frequent monitoring. Medicines may be given through a vein over several days. Although the infusion phase may be relatively short, hospitalization can continue for weeks while blood counts recover and clinicians watch for infection, bleeding or other complications.

After induction, a bone marrow examination is usually performed to assess response. If remission is achieved, consolidation therapy is planned. This may involve additional chemotherapy cycles, targeted therapy for selected AML types, or preparation for a stem cell transplant. The exact schedule depends on AML risk features and recovery after each phase.

  • Before treatment: tests, treatment planning and placement of venous access if needed.
  • Induction: treatment designed to bring AML into remission.
  • Response assessment: blood and bone marrow tests after treatment.
  • Consolidation: further treatment to reduce the chance of relapse.

How many rounds of chemo is normal for AML?

There is no single normal number of chemotherapy rounds for AML. Many people receive one induction course, while some need a second course if the first does not produce remission. Once remission is reached, consolidation usually involves additional courses, but the number, intensity and timing depend on the individual treatment plan.

AML risk category has an important role. People with favorable-risk disease may receive chemotherapy-based consolidation, whereas those with higher-risk genetic features may be advised to consider a stem cell transplant in first remission if they are eligible. Lower-intensity treatment approaches may be given in repeated cycles over a longer period.

The oncology team does not decide on treatment by counting cycles alone. Bone marrow results, minimal residual disease testing where available, side effects, blood count recovery and the person’s overall condition all help determine whether treatment should continue, change or move to transplant planning.

How long does chemo take for acute myeloid leukemia?

The active infusion days for an AML chemotherapy course may last days, but the overall treatment and recovery period is usually much longer. Intensive induction often requires a hospital stay of several weeks because blood counts can remain low after chemotherapy. This is followed by testing to confirm whether remission has been achieved.

Consolidation treatment may take several additional months, with time between courses to allow the bone marrow and body to recover. Appointments continue after treatment for blood tests, follow-up visits and, when indicated, bone marrow examinations. The total timeline can therefore range from months to longer, particularly when lower-intensity ongoing therapy or transplantation is part of care.

Recovery schedules differ considerably. Some people regain strength gradually between cycles, while others need more time because of infection, fatigue, nutritional concerns or effects on other organs. The treating team can provide the most accurate estimate based on the selected regimen and the person’s progress.

Benefits, risks and recovery during treatment

The key potential benefit of chemotherapy is achieving remission and reducing the amount of leukemia in the body. Further treatment after remission is intended to lower the risk that AML returns. In selected circumstances, chemotherapy can also prepare the body for a transplant, which may offer an additional chance of long-term disease control for some people.

Because chemotherapy affects healthy rapidly dividing cells as well as leukemia cells, side effects are common. These can include tiredness, nausea, mouth sores, appetite changes, hair loss, diarrhea or constipation, and temporary changes in fertility. The most important short-term risks are low white blood cell counts, infection, anemia and low platelets that may increase bruising or bleeding.

During low blood counts, the team may provide antibiotics or other preventive medicines, blood or platelet transfusions, anti-sickness medicines and nutritional support. People should follow their team’s advice about hand hygiene, food safety, activity, medicines and contact with people who are unwell. Side effects should be reported early, as many can be treated or managed effectively.

Is AML considered a terminal illness?

AML is a serious and potentially life-threatening blood cancer, but it is not automatically considered a terminal illness. Outcomes vary according to the AML subtype, genetic features, age, general health, response to treatment and whether the disease returns after remission. Modern treatment plans are increasingly tailored using these factors.

Some people achieve remission after initial treatment and remain free of detectable leukemia long term. Others may need further therapy if AML does not respond fully or returns. Even when cure is less likely, treatment may still help control leukemia, relieve symptoms and support quality of life.

Clear discussions with the hematology team can help people understand their own outlook rather than relying on general predictions. Supportive and palliative care can be used alongside active cancer treatment at any stage to help manage symptoms, emotional wellbeing and practical needs.

Can you fully recover from acute myeloid leukemia?

Some people can achieve long-term remission and may be considered cured of AML, especially when leukemia does not return after an extended period of follow-up. However, no clinician can promise cure at diagnosis because AML is biologically diverse and relapse remains possible for some individuals.

The likelihood of long-term recovery depends on factors such as the genetic profile of the leukemia cells, whether complete remission is achieved, the depth of response on sensitive testing, age and overall health. Consolidation chemotherapy, targeted therapies and stem cell transplantation are chosen to improve the chance of durable disease control when appropriate.

Follow-up after treatment is an important part of recovery. It commonly includes regular blood counts, clinical reviews and bone marrow testing if there are concerns about relapse. Emotional recovery, rebuilding physical strength and managing late effects also deserve attention after intensive treatment.

When to seek medical care

Anyone receiving AML chemotherapy should contact their treatment team promptly if they develop a fever, chills, new cough, shortness of breath, burning when passing urine, severe diarrhea, persistent vomiting, confusion, severe weakness, unusual bruising or bleeding. These symptoms can be signs of infection, low blood counts or treatment complications that need timely assessment.

Emergency care is appropriate for severe breathing difficulty, chest pain, fainting, uncontrolled bleeding, sudden confusion or a rapidly worsening condition. People should not take fever-reducing medicines to mask a fever before speaking with their oncology team unless they have been specifically advised to do so.

Before chemotherapy begins, the care team provides a direct contact number and explains which symptoms require urgent review. Keeping this information accessible, attending scheduled blood tests and raising concerns early can make treatment safer and more manageable.

Frequently asked questions

What is the main goal of chemotherapy for acute myeloid leukemia?

The first goal is usually to bring AML into remission by clearing detectable leukemia cells from the blood and bone marrow. Treatment after remission aims to eliminate remaining leukemia cells and reduce the chance that AML returns.

Is chemotherapy always used for AML?

Chemotherapy is a central treatment for many people with AML, particularly those able to receive intensive therapy. Some people may receive lower-intensity medicines, targeted therapies, supportive care, or a combination of approaches based on their health and AML characteristics.

Will AML chemotherapy require a hospital stay?

Intensive induction chemotherapy commonly requires hospitalization because blood counts may become very low and complications need close monitoring. Later treatment may sometimes be delivered partly as an outpatient, depending on the regimen and the person’s clinical condition.

What happens if AML does not go into remission after chemotherapy?

The care team may recommend another treatment regimen, a targeted medicine if an appropriate genetic change is present, a clinical trial, or evaluation for stem cell transplantation. The choice depends on previous treatment, test results and overall health.

Can chemotherapy side effects be managed?

Many side effects can be prevented, reduced or treated with supportive medicines and close monitoring. Transfusions, infection prevention, anti-nausea treatment, nutritional support and early assessment of symptoms are important parts of AML care.

How is relapse monitored after AML treatment?

Follow-up usually includes regular clinical visits and blood tests. Bone marrow testing and specialized tests may be used when needed to look for signs of residual or returning leukemia.
